Number

$828 \, 828$ (eight hundred and twenty-eight thousand, eight hundred and twenty-eight) is:

$2^2 \times 3^2 \times 7 \times 11 \times 13 \times 23$


The $16$th palindromic triangular number after $0$, $1$, $3$, $6$, $55$, $66$, $171$, $595$, $666$, $3003$, $5995$, $8778$, $15 \, 051$, $66 \, 066$, $617 \, 716$:
$828 \, 828 = \dfrac {1287 \times \paren {1287 + 1} } 2$
The $3$rd of those after $55$, $66$, and largest known, which can be split into two palindromic halves


The $1287$th triangular number:
$828 \, 828 = \dfrac {1287 \times \paren {1287 + 1} } 2$
